This webinar addresses person-centered approaches in Information & Referral/Assistance (I&R/A) practice, focusing on how specialists can center conversations on what truly matters to the people they serve. The webinar explored the foundations of person-centered thinking, counseling, and practice; examined how these approaches differ from eligibility-driven models; and identified practical skills such as active listening and strengths-based thinking that support person-focused engagement. Through the webinar, practice identifying what is important to and important for individuals and learn how to apply these concepts across consumer access systems to support dignity, choice, and meaningful community living.
